SAP性能优化指南

SAP性能优化指南 pdf epub mobi txt 电子书 下载 2026

出版者:东方出版社
作者:托马斯·施奈
出品人:
页数:482
译者:
出版时间:2006-1
价格:59.00元
装帧:简裝本
isbn号码:9787506023627
丛书系列:
图书标签:
  • 性能优化
  • sap
  • SAP
  • 性能优化指南
  • tech
  • SAP
  • 性能优化
  • ABAP
  • 数据库
  • 系统管理
  • 监控
  • 调优
  • S/4HANA
  • HANA
  • 配置
想要找书就要到 小哈图书下载中心
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

SAP性能优化指南,ISBN:9787506023627,作者:托马斯·施奈德 著,勾侃 译

《现代数据库系统架构与性能调优实战》 书籍简介 在数据爆炸性增长的今天,企业对于数据库系统的依赖达到了前所未有的高度。从在线交易处理(OLTP)到复杂的决策支持系统(OLAP),数据库的性能直接关系到业务的成败。然而,随着系统负载的增加和数据量的膨胀,单纯依赖硬件升级已无法满足需求,精细化的系统架构设计与深入的性能调优技术成为了企业IT部门的核心竞争力。 本书《现代数据库系统架构与调优实战》并非SAP特定技术的指南,而是聚焦于通用的、面向企业级数据库系统的全景式优化策略与实践。它旨在为系统架构师、数据库管理员(DBA)以及高级开发人员提供一套系统化、可落地的性能优化方法论,涵盖从硬件选型、操作系统内核参数配置,到数据库实例调优、SQL语句重构,直至分布式数据架构下的性能挑战与解决方案。 第一部分:基础夯实——理解性能的基石 本部分深入剖析了影响数据库性能的底层因素。我们首先从服务器硬件层面入手,详细讲解了CPU拓扑结构、内存层次结构(L1/L2/L3 Cache、主存延迟)如何影响数据库操作的响应时间。随后,重点探讨了存储I/O子系统的设计,包括不同类型存储(SSD/NVMe、SAN/NAS)的I/O特性分析、文件系统选择(如XFS与EXT4在数据库场景下的优劣),以及如何通过I/O调度器参数优化,确保数据库的读写请求能够以最低的延迟被满足。 操作系统层面是数据库性能的另一关键瓶颈。书中详尽剖析了Linux内核参数对数据库工作负载的影响,例如,如何正确设置系统最大文件句柄数、TCP/IP协议栈的调优(如缓冲区大小、延迟确认机制),以及内存管理策略(如Huge Pages的使用与配置),确保操作系统能够为数据库进程提供最优的资源环境。我们提供了大量的实战案例,展示了如何通过`vmstat`、`iostat`、`perf`等工具对系统瓶颈进行初级诊断。 第二部分:关系型数据库核心优化技术 本部分是本书的核心,专注于主流关系型数据库(如PostgreSQL、MySQL/MariaDB、Oracle等,但不限于任何特定商业套件)的内部机制与精细化调优。 索引策略与执行计划分析: 性能优化的核心在于高效的数据检索。本书超越了基础的B-Tree索引知识,深入探讨了LSM-Tree、Hash索引、空间索引等高级索引结构的应用场景。我们详细介绍了查询优化器的工作原理,如何通过分析执行计划(Explain Plan)识别索引失效、全表扫描、不合理的连接顺序等问题。书中提供了大量的“坏SQL”到“好SQL”的重构案例,强调了基于成本的优化器(CBO)的局限性及人工干预的必要性。 并发控制与事务隔离: 锁竞争是导致OLTP系统性能下降的常见原因。本书深入解析了多版本并发控制(MVCC)的内部实现机制,不同隔离级别(Read Committed, Repeatable Read, Serializable)下的锁行为差异,以及死锁的检测与预防策略。针对高并发场景,我们探讨了如何通过细化事务粒度、优化锁类型选择、利用乐观锁机制来最大化吞吐量。 内存管理与缓冲池调优: 数据库的性能在很大程度上取决于其内存使用效率。我们将讲解共享缓冲池(Shared Buffer)的有效分配策略,如何平衡数据缓存与日志缓冲区的需求,以及如何监控脏页比例、检查点(Checkpoint)频率对I/O抖动的影响,确保热点数据尽可能长时间地驻留在内存中。 日志与恢复机制优化: 事务日志(如WAL、Redo Log)的写入性能直接影响了事务的提交延迟。本书详细分析了日志写入的同步策略(如`fsync`的开销),以及如何通过调整日志段大小和预分配策略,实现高吞吐量的持久化写入。 第三部分:面向大数据量的架构扩展与性能挑战 随着数据量的增长,单机数据库的性能瓶颈变得不可避免。本部分聚焦于如何通过架构设计来水平扩展系统的处理能力。 读写分离与数据冗余: 我们详细介绍了主从复制(Master-Slave)的同步机制(基于日志或触发器),同步复制与异步复制的权衡,以及如何构建高效的读写分离集群以分散读取压力。针对数据一致性要求高的场景,我们探讨了基于Quorum机制的分布式一致性协议。 数据分片(Sharding)策略: 分布式数据库环境下的性能优化,关键在于数据如何合理分布。本书深入探讨了分片键的选择、散列分片、范围分片、目录分片等不同策略的优缺点,以及如何处理跨分片事务和热点数据倾斜问题,确保查询负载均匀分布在所有节点上。 NoSQL与混合数据模型: 现代应用往往需要处理结构化、半结构化及非结构化数据。本书分析了何时使用键值存储(Key-Value Store)、文档数据库(Document DB)或列式存储(Columnar Store)来替代或补充传统RDBMS,以及如何设计数据模型以最大化特定类型查询的性能。 第四部分:自动化监控与性能生命周期管理 性能优化是一个持续的过程,而非一次性任务。本部分侧重于构建一个健壮的性能监控体系。 基准测试与负载模拟: 强调了在不影响生产环境的前提下,如何构建真实的工作负载模型进行压力测试。书中介绍了业界常用的基准测试工具,以及如何解读测试结果,识别系统瓶颈。 性能指标的黄金标准: 区分吞吐量(Throughput)、延迟(Latency)和资源利用率(Utilization)等关键指标。重点讲解了如何设置有效的性能阈值,并利用时间序列数据库(TSDB)和可视化工具(如Grafana)构建实时、可追溯的性能仪表盘,实现主动式性能预警。 自动化调优与机器学习在DBA中的应用: 探讨了利用自动化工具对参数进行迭代优化(如利用贝叶斯优化寻找最优配置集),以及如何利用历史性能数据训练模型,预测未来的性能趋势和潜在风险。 目标读者 本书适合具备一定数据库基础知识,希望将性能调优能力提升到架构层面的专业人士,包括企业级DBA、高级后端工程师、系统架构师以及负责关键业务系统稳定运行的技术主管。通过本书的学习,读者将掌握一套从硬件到应用层面的全栈性能优化思维框架,能够自信地应对高并发、大数据量带来的复杂性能挑战。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

坦白说,当我拿到这本书的时候,我其实是有些担忧的。毕竟,SAP性能优化是一个非常技术化且门槛很高的领域,而且SAP的版本更新很快,技术也在不断发展,担心这本书的内容会不会有些过时。但是,当我翻开目录,看到其中包含的关于SAP HANA性能优化的内容时,我的顾虑消减了不少。HANA作为SAP最新的内存数据库,其性能优化策略与传统的数据库有着很大的区别。书中对HANA的内存管理、查询优化、数据模型设计等方面的探讨,让我觉得这本书还是紧跟技术发展的步伐的。我特别期待书中关于HANA性能瓶颈的诊断方法,以及如何通过HANA Studio等工具来分析和优化查询。另外,我也很想了解书中是否包含了一些关于SAP Fiori应用性能优化的内容。随着SAP向云端迁移,Fiori应用越来越普及,其性能也直接影响到用户的体验。如果这本书能涵盖这方面的内容,那就更完美了。

评分

这本书的出版,对于所有在SAP环境中苦苦挣扎于性能问题的技术人员来说,无疑是一场及时雨。我一直觉得,SAP系统就像一个庞大的有机体,任何一个环节出了问题,都会牵一发而动全身。尤其是当我们面对日益增长的数据量和越来越复杂的业务流程时,性能问题就更加凸显。我曾多次在项目中遇到过报表执行缓慢、事务处理延迟、甚至系统整体响应迟钝的情况,这些问题不仅影响了业务部门的工作效率,也让项目实施和维护的团队焦头烂额。这本书的出现,为我们提供了一个系统性的解决方案。我尤其欣赏书中关于性能问题的诊断和定位的章节,它不仅列举了可能出现的各种性能瓶颈,还提供了详细的分析工具和方法。比如,如何利用SAP自带的ST05、ST04等事务码来分析SQL语句的执行情况,如何通过SAT工具来分析ABAP程序的性能,以及如何利用OS和数据库层面的工具来排查问题。这些实操性的指导,对于我们这些一线技术人员来说,是极其宝贵的。我非常期待书中关于内存管理、CPU使用率、I/O瓶颈等方面的深入探讨,以及如何通过调整操作系统参数、数据库配置等方式来缓解这些问题。同时,我也希望书中能提供一些案例分析,通过实际项目的经验来印证这些优化方法的效果。

评分

这本书的作者,一定是一位非常有耐心且善于沟通的人。从书中对SAP性能优化相关概念的解释,到对各种优化技术的阐述,都做到了条理清晰、深入浅出。即使是对于我这样在SAP领域工作多年但并非专门从事性能优化的人来说,也能轻松理解其中的内容。我尤其关注书中关于SAP系统中常见性能瓶颈的分析和解决策略。比如,关于并发用户数过多时系统响应变慢的原因,关于网络延迟对SAP应用的影响,以及如何通过缓存机制来提升系统性能等等。这些都是我们在日常工作中经常会遇到的问题,但往往难以找到根本的解决方案。这本书的出现,为我们提供了一个全面、系统的指导,让我对如何应对这些挑战充满了信心。我希望这本书能成为我日常工作中必备的参考手册。

评分

这本书的装帧设计倒是挺不错的,纸张的手感温润,封面颜色搭配也很沉静,一看就是那种沉甸甸的专业书籍,我拿到手的时候就觉得分量很足,迫不及待地想翻开看看里面到底写了些什么。首先吸引我的是它的目录,结构清晰,层层递进,从最基础的概念讲起,然后逐步深入到一些更复杂的议题。作为一名SAP顾问,我一直对性能优化这个话题很感兴趣,因为在实际项目中,性能问题总是层出不穷,有时候一个微小的优化就能带来显著的提升,改善用户体验,甚至节约大量的服务器资源。这本书从理论到实践,似乎都给出了详细的介绍。我特别关注的是书中关于数据库层面优化的部分,比如索引的创建和维护,SQL语句的编写规范,以及数据库参数的调优。我知道,SAP的性能瓶颈很多时候都出在数据库层面,如果数据库跑得慢,整个系统都会受影响。另外,我也很期待书中关于应用服务器和前端性能的论述,包括ABAP代码的优化技巧、报表执行效率的提升方法,以及用户界面的响应速度的改善策略。这本书的作者应该是有多年SAP项目经验的专家,从目录上看,他/她对SAP系统的各个方面都有深入的理解,这让我对书中的内容充满了信心。希望这本书能真正地帮助我解决工作中遇到的实际问题,提升我作为SAP顾问的专业技能。

评分

读完这本书的某个章节,我深有感触。书中对于ABAP性能的讲解,让我对很多我以前认为理所当然的编程方式产生了怀疑。比如,书中提到的一些内表操作的效率对比,让我意识到,即使是看起来很小的代码差异,在处理大量数据时,其性能差距也是非常巨大的。这让我开始反思自己以往的编程习惯,并尝试去学习书中提供的一些更优化的编程模式。我特别期待书中关于如何优化复杂的ABAP报表和后台作业的内容。这些程序往往是SAP系统中消耗资源最多的部分,也是性能问题的重灾区。如果能掌握一套行之有效的优化方法,不仅能提升用户的工作效率,还能显著降低服务器的运行成本。书中提到的关于性能测试工具和方法的介绍,也让我觉得非常实用,我迫不及待地想将这些方法应用到我的实际工作中去。

评分

这本书的作者,在SAP性能优化领域绝对是专家级的存在。从他对SAP系统各个组件之间关系的深刻理解,到他对各种性能问题根源的精准定位,都让我惊叹不已。我曾多次在项目中遇到过一些难以捉磨的性能问题,花费了大量的时间和精力去排查,但收效甚微。而这本书,就像一个经验丰富的向导,为我指明了方向。我尤其欣赏书中关于“预防胜于治疗”的理念,以及如何通过系统化的方法来避免性能问题的发生。例如,在项目初期进行充分的性能需求分析,在开发过程中遵循严格的代码编写规范,在系统上线前进行全面的压力测试等等。这些看似简单但却至关重要的环节,往往容易被忽视。这本书的出现,提醒了我们这些SAP从业者,要将性能优化融入到SAP项目的每一个阶段,而不是等到问题出现后再去亡羊补牢。

评分

这本书的作者,我对他/她的专业能力可以说是非常钦佩。从书中对SAP系统底层原理的讲解,以及对各种性能优化策略的阐述,都透露出一种扎实的功底和丰富的实践经验。我曾接触过一些关于SAP性能优化的书籍,但很多都停留在表面,或者过于理论化,难以在实际项目中落地。而这本书,我感觉它更接地气,更注重实操性。特别是关于ABAP代码的优化,作者提供了一些非常具体的技巧,比如如何避免不必要的循环、如何使用高效的内表操作、如何合理地利用数据库索引等等。这些看似微小的改变,却能在实际运行中带来巨大的性能提升。我记得在我之前的一个项目中,一个复杂的报表执行时间长达十几分钟,通过分析,我们发现是因为ABAP代码中存在一些低效的内表操作,改写了这部分代码后,执行时间缩短到了几十秒,用户满意度大大提升。这本书的出现,让我有信心去应对更多类似的挑战。我还非常关注书中关于SAP NetWeaver平台的性能优化,包括消息服务器、网关、工作进程等组件的配置和调优。这些底层组件的性能直接影响到整个系统的稳定性和响应速度。

评分

我对这本书的期待,不仅仅在于它能解决我当前遇到的SAP性能问题,更在于它能帮助我提升我的专业认知和技能水平。SAP系统的复杂性毋庸置疑,而性能优化更是其中的一个高深领域。这本书能够系统性地梳理SAP性能优化的方方面面,并提供详细的解释和实践建议,这本身就是一项了不起的成就。我特别欣赏书中关于系统架构对性能影响的论述。理解SAP各个组件是如何协同工作的,以及它们之间的性能耦合关系,对于做出更有效的优化决策至关重要。我希望书中能提供一些关于如何根据具体的业务场景来选择和配置SAP组件的建议,以及如何评估不同架构对系统整体性能的影响。

评分

作为一名SAP Basis管理员,我对这本书寄予厚望。因为在SAP系统中,Basis的职责范围非常广泛,而性能优化绝对是其中最核心、最复杂的部分之一。我们不仅要负责系统的安装、配置、升级、打补丁,更要确保系统能够高效、稳定地运行。当用户抱怨系统慢的时候,第一个被问到的往往就是Basis。这本书从一个非常宏观的视角,将SAP性能优化拆解成了多个可管理的模块,比如数据库性能、应用服务器性能、网络性能、前端性能等等。我特别关注书中关于数据库参数调优的部分,我知道,不同的数据库(如Oracle, HANA, SQL Server)有其各自的参数设置原则,而这些参数的合理配置,对SAP系统的整体性能至关重要。此外,书中关于SAP应用服务器(AS ABAP, AS Java)的调优,包括内存配置、CPU使用、线程管理等,也是我非常感兴趣的内容。我希望这本书能提供一些具体的操作指南,帮助我更好地理解和应用这些调优技术。

评分

我一直认为,SAP系统的性能优化是一个持续的、系统性的工程,而不是一蹴而就的事情。这本书,恰恰为我们提供了一个完整的路线图。从系统的初期设计、开发阶段的编码规范,到上线后的日常监控、定期调优,这本书都给出了详细的指导。我尤其欣赏书中关于性能基准测试和持续监控的部分。很多时候,我们只关注问题发生后的解决,却忽略了在问题发生前进行预防。通过建立完善的性能基准,并实施有效的持续监控,我们可以在潜在的性能问题演变成重大故障之前将其扼杀在摇篮里。书中关于监控工具和报警机制的介绍,也让我眼前一亮。我知道,SAP提供了一系列强大的监控工具,但如何有效地利用这些工具,并设置合理的报警阈值,需要一定的经验。这本书的作者在这方面应该有独到的见解。我期待书中能更详细地阐述如何根据业务需求和系统负载来制定不同的监控策略,以及如何根据监控结果来调整优化方案。

评分

经典之作!

评分

经典之作!

评分

经典之作!

评分

经典之作!

评分

经典之作!

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 qciss.net All Rights Reserved. 小哈图书下载中心 版权所有